WebFeatures:Durable Construction: Durable and dense brush materials create long lasting bristles for strong cleaning ability but won't scratch the toilet bowl.Efficient Cleaning: The F-type brush head is designed to better clean all corners of the toilet bowl by bending the brush head to different angles.Compact Space Saving Design: Unlike traditional toilet … WebJun 12, 2024 · Remove metal scratches from toilet bowls You’re supposed to use a closet auger to remove toilet clogs. But many DIYers don’t have one and use a regular snake. Sure, it works, but it can also leave metal scratches on the bowl. If that happens to you, don’t freak out. Just pick up a pumice stone from any home center.

Because you’re … isaac mathews musicWebToilet auger marks are made from the steel cable scraping the china surface of the bowl, which deposit rust. To remove marks left from a toilet auger: • Remove the water from the bowl • Use a little rust remover, such as CLR or ZAP For more Seattle plumbing tips, check out our Web site or call 1-800-GET-ROTO to schedule service.
